ABSTRACT:
A brushless direct current outer rotor motor with a substantially cylindrical air gap (14), particularly for driving magnetic disks. The rotor (16) of the motor (10) supports a permanently-magnetized exciter magnet (13, 13") having at least two pairs of poles and a permanently-magnetized control magnet (18, 18', 18"). At least one detector (20, 34, 26) of rotary position cooperates with its control magnet, and is responsive to the magnetic field to sense the position of the rotor. There is also provided commutating means (32) responsive to the detector of the rotary position, and a stator winding means (12) connected to the commutating means. A control pulse generator stage (21,29; 35,36; 47,55) adapted to generate one pulse only per each revolution of the rotor (16) is coordinated with the control magnet (18, 18', 18").
